Comprehensive Guide to Door Repairs: Understanding the Process, Costs, and Techniques
Doors are important elements of every home and business, supplying security, personal privacy, and aesthetics. However, wear and tear can lead to numerous problems, demanding door repairs. This post explores common door problems, repair methods, associated expenses, and regularly asked questions about door repairs.
Kinds Of Door Repairs
Doors can suffer from a variety of concerns depending on their type, material, and use. Some of the most common kinds of door repairs include:
Hinge Repairs:
- Loose hinges causing doors to droop.
- Rusty hinges that need replacement or lubrication.
Door Frames:
- Damaged or warped frames from weather direct exposure.
- Fractures or splits in the frame.
Locks and Latches:
- Broken locks that need replacement.
- Misaligned latches avoiding appropriate closure.
Surface Damage:
- Scratches, damages, and holes in wooden or metal Doors Repairs.
- Faded paint or finish needing repainting or refinishing.
Weather Stripping:
- Worn out or damaged weather condition removing allowing drafts or wetness.
Step-by-Step Guide to Common Door Repairs
Below are numerous typical door repair techniques, describing actions and necessary materials.
Repairing a Sagging Door
A drooping door can be an annoyance, typically triggered by loose hinges or a warped frame.
Materials Needed:
- Screwdriver
- Wood shim
- Level
Steps:
- Check Hinge Screws: Inspect the hinge screws for tightness. If they are loose, tighten them utilizing a screwdriver.
- Use a Level: Place a level versus the door to see how far it is sagging.
- Place Shims: If the door is drooping significantly, insert a wood shim behind the top hinge. This can assist raise the door back into place.
- Re-tighten Screws: After adjusting the shim, re-tighten the hinge screws. Test the door and make additional changes if required.
Fixing a Sticky Door
A sticky door can be triggered by humidity, temperature modifications, or misalignment.
Materials Needed:
- Sandpaper or a hand aircraft
- Screwdriver
Steps:
- Inspect for Rubbing: Close the door and check which areas are rubbing against the frame.
- Get Rid Of Door if Necessary: If substantial change is needed, get rid of the door utilizing a screwdriver.
- Sand the Rubbing Areas: Use sandpaper or a hand airplane to shave down the areas that are sticking. Be patient and test often.
- Rehang and Adjust: Rehang the door and make any last adjustments.
Replacing a Door Lock
A malfunctioning lock can posture security risks and trouble.
Materials Needed:
- New lock set
- Screwdriver
- Determining tape
Actions:
- Remove the Old Lock: Unscrew the existing lockset from both the interior and exterior sides of the door.
- Step and Prepare: Measure the door's thickness and the existing holes to make sure an appropriate suitable for the new lock.
- Set Up the New Lock: Follow the manufacturer's guidelines to set up the brand-new lock, ensuring it's correctly aligned and safely attached.
- Test the Lock: Test the lock to ensure it operates smoothly.
Repainting or Refinishing a Door
Doors can begin to look worn with time, requiring a fresh coat of paint or stain.
Materials Needed:
- Paint or stain
- Guide (if painting)
- Paintbrush or roller
- Sandpaper
- Clean cloth
Steps:
- Remove Hardware: Take off doorknobs and other hardware to make painting simpler.
- Sand the Surface: Lightly sand the door to eliminate old paint or stain and develop a smooth surface for adhesion.
- Clean the Door: Wipe the door with a tidy fabric to eliminate dust and debris.
- Apply Primer: If painting, use a coat of guide.
- Paint or Stain: Apply the selected paint or stain with even strokes, enabling each coat to dry thoroughly before adding extra coats.
Expense Involved in Door Repairs
The expense of door repairs can differ substantially based on the kind of repair required and your geographical location. Below is a basic introduction of expected expenses:
Repair Type | Estimated Cost Range |
---|---|
Hinge repairs | ₤ 10 - ₤ 50 |
Frame repair | ₤ 50 - ₤ 200 |
Lock replacement | ₤ 30 - ₤ 150 |
Surface area refinishing | ₤ 50 - ₤ 300 |
Weather removing | ₤ 10 - ₤ 50 |
Note: The costs may exclude any prospective labor charges if hiring an expert.
Often Asked Questions About Door Repairs
1. How do I know if my door needs repair?
Indications of damage, problem in opening or closing, and visible wear and tear are signs that your door may need repair.
2. Can I repair my door myself, or should I employ an expert?
Many little repairs can be done by homeowners with basic tools. However, for complex concerns, or if you lack the needed skills, it might be a good idea to work with an expert.
3. How frequently should I inspect my doors?
Regular assessments (a minimum of as soon as a year) are recommended to guarantee that doors stay in great condition. Search for indications of damage and deal with any issues promptly.
4. What materials are best for door repairs?
For wood doors, wood glue and wood filler are perfect, while metal doors might need a metal patching compound. Always utilize weather-resistant materials for outdoor doors.
5. Can a deformed door be fixed?
In lots of cases, a warped door can be repaired by straightening or replacing the hinges or by applying moisture and heat to bring back the initial shape. However, extreme warping might necessitate door replacement.
